Kaleva Oy modernize with stitchers from Tolerans

Press release from the issuing company

Kaleva Oy has equipped their new manroland Colorman with six Tolerans SPEEDLINER® 2.0 ribbon stitchers and two SPEEDLINER® 2.0 cylinder stitchers.

In December 2012 Tolerans commissioned eight SPEEDLINER® 2.0 to Kaleva Printing in Oulu, Finland

Ribbon stitching enables production of stitched sectionized tabloid

The set-up gives Kaleva full flexibility to produce stitched sectionized tabloid in one press run.
